Syringe Filter Selection Guide

Syringe filter housings are manufactured from solvent-resistant, low-extractable polypropylene resins specifically selected for wide compatibility with common HPLC sample matrices.

Select Filter Membrane According to the Sample Characteristics and Filtering Objective

Membrane Type

 Recommended Application

 Nylon

Hydrophilic in nature and frequently utilized for the preparation of aqueous or mixed organic samples, as well as for HPLC, GC, or dissolution sample analysis, including bases, the majority of HPLC solvents, alcohols, aromatic hydrocarbons, and THF. It is not suitable for strong acids, strong bases, or applications requiring high protein recovery. It offers excellent flow rates across most sample matrices and exhibits extremely low levels of extractables.

 

  PTFE

Hydrophobic and ideal for samples based on organic solvents, whether acidic or basic, as well as all types of solvents, including aggressive solvents, strong acids and bases, alcohols, and aromatics.

It exhibits chemical resistance to all solvents and possesses remarkable thermal stability when exposed to high-temperature fluids.

This material can also be utilized with aqueous samples following a pre-wetting process with a small quantity of alcohol, subsequently followed by a flushing with water.

 

  PVDF

Characterized by hydrophobic properties and exceptional suitability for HPLC and GC sample preparation and purification, particularly for protein-based samples, this material boasts extensive chemical compatibility, a low protein binder, and minimal UV-absorbing extractables. It is applicable for use with alcohols, weak acids, proteins, peptides, and various other biomolecules, facilitating high protein recovery.


  PES

The PES membrane is hydrophilic and highly suitable for tissue culture, media, and buffers, owing to its minimal binding of proteins and nucleic acids, as well as its superior flow rates. Compared to cellulose acetate, it exhibits enhanced chemical resistance. This membrane finds extensive application in clinical and toxicological settings, ion chromatography, ICP-MS, AAS, and capillary electrophoresis, particularly for strong bases, alcohols, proteins, and peptides.

 

  MCE

Hydrophilic and suitable for the filtration of aqueous samples requiring elevated flow rates and larger volumes, this includes processes such as the clarification or sterilization of aqueous solutions, particulate analysis and removal, air monitoring, microbial analysis, cytology, preparation and cleanup of HPLC samples, virus concentration, biological assays, and food microbiology (specifically the enumeration of E. coli in food products), as well as bacteriological studies.
